#928157 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#928157 is composed of 57.3% red, 50.6%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 42.7 degrees, a saturation of 25.3% and a lightness of 45.7%. #928157 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#250300.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#928157

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0a06 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#928157

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777672 is the less saturated color, while #e3a306 is the most saturated one.
